Hi folks, relatively new to the site so maybe I am missing something.
I often go to my collection page and click on the link which matches items on my trade/for sale list with items on other people's wantlists. I then select a set and see a list of cards with matches. All good so far. If I click on view matches next to a card I get a list of people with that card in their collection or on their wantlist or on their trade/for sale list. Ok so the people with the card on their wantlist on my potential trading partners. The only problem is out of those people there does not seem to be an easy way to identify anyone who has something on my wantlist, except for clicking on each name and trying the matching process. This is labour intensive and often leads no where. Is there a way to streamline this process? Am I missing something?

For me the easiest way is to have Receive alerts when items on my want list and FS/FT list accures.
Check to see if you have your Receive alerts when items on your Wantlist or For Sale / Trade match other members' lists? turned off. That way you get matches every day or every hour and it shows match for card you need and what others need.

The fastest way is to post a thread in the For Sale/Trade Forum stating that you are looking to trade. Then the active traders will come to you! Usually, they will check what you have and see if they have stuff you want before contacting you with either a PM or Transaction Offer.

Gator, you are bang on. I rarely propose a trade as I receive so many without doing so. I can always counter these trades if there is something I want more specifically from someone. I have over 64,000 different baseball cards listed for trade, some in the other sports and non-sports categories, plus many more on my other ID. And I have a fairly expansive want list of 43,000 cards which I grew only to be able to make larger trades with someone who wanted many of my traders. And I am a very active trader who responds and fills trades quite quickly (usually within 24 hours), 16 of them on the go right now 4 of which were done this weekend and dropped in the mail this morning.
When I have looked for possible trades with someone who has somethign specific I would like, I find that many of the want list are very limited. And when someone asks for something from me, I check what they have for trade and it often is everything that they are already offering. So either they have very limited quantity to trade (if so, I suggest building up your trade pile if trading is what you want to do) or they only load "For Trade" what they are willing to offer which does not leave me any options other than take it or leave it.
